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
130 8361 016324 83250
30678 83 596
30678 83 596
87026256 12063 13022678 008162 2457
All about undefined
Interested in learning more?
30678 83 596
87026256 12063 13022678 008162 2457
See more
9357 490541317 315
02 35060 6499337
See more
5984 9392868 91
7350976021 3265153 42781 26
See more